Children with Down syndrome … Web2 feb. 2024 · Can two down syndromes have a baby? A woman with Down’s syndrome can have children. If her partner does not have Down’s syndrome, the theoretical chance of the child having Down’s syndrome is 50\%. There have been only a few reports of men with Down’s syndrome fathering children. Web11 jun. 2014 · People do ask about that — but most children with Down syndrome are born to women younger than 35 years old simply because younger women have more … Web23 okt. 2024 · People with Down syndrome rarely reproduce. About 15% to 30% of women with trisomy 21 are fertile, and they have a 50% risk of having an affected child. Men …
